Spencer Eye Hospital

Spencer Eye Hospital is listed in Eye Care, and located in Karachi Pakistan. The phone number is 021-2731351 / 2731348 / 2731349 / 2731350, and the address is Siddique Wahab Road Lea Market, Karachi, Sindh, Pakistan. Spencer Eye Hospital is part of Health And Medical Directory, find complete contact details, email address and website address with location maps and owner name.

Business NameSpencer Eye Hospital
Business TypeEye Care
Phone #021-2731351 / 2731348 / 2731349 / 2731350
CityKarachi
AddressSiddique Wahab Road Lea Market, Karachi, Sindh, Pakistan

Health And Medical Business Types

More Business Types

Find Business in Your City

Write Your Comments

CAPTCHA Reload